The DoD Procurement, Compliance & Innovation conference is a premier event organized by the American Conference Institute, scheduled for December 10–11, 2026, in Washington, DC. This conference focuses on the latest developments in defense procurement, compliance, and innovation, providing a platform for industry leaders and government officials to discuss and navigate the evolving landscape of defense acquisition.

Key topics include the implications of the Revolutionary FAR Overhaul (RFO), strategies for adapting to recent Executive Orders affecting procurement and cybersecurity, and advancements in defense systems through AI and data-driven decision-making. Sessions will also address compliance challenges, the operational transformation of the defense industrial base, and strategies to mitigate risks associated with contract terminations and stop-work orders.
